Review summaries for Altra Homecare of South Bend emphasize a consistent pattern of positive caregiver qualities. Caregivers are repeatedly described as compassionate, patient, kind and attentive; families characterize the relationship as personable and family-like. Reviewers highlighted specific strengths in personal interaction — supportive communication, attentiveness, and a tendency to go beyond basic tasks — which together suggest a strong client-facing culture focused on respectful, warm care.
Office and management functions receive similarly favorable notice. Several reviews call out a professional, helpful office staff and recruiters, with clear explanations, respectful interactions, and an organized onboarding process. Orientation and training are described as thorough and welcoming, and reviewers report quick, responsive communication and prompt phone pickup. These observations point to effective front-office processes and hands-on management oversight.
Reliability and continuity are recurring themes: reviewers emphasize dependable shift coverage, continuity of caregivers, and safety-oriented policies. While specifics about scheduling flexibility (for example, last-minute swaps or extended-hour requests) are limited in the summaries, the overall tone indicates timely coordination and practical responsiveness when arranging care. The agency's approach appears oriented toward consistent assignments and maintaining ongoing caregiver–client relationships.
Areas for prospective clients to consider relate largely to the agency's stage of development and gaps in publicly available detail. The business is described as new and growing; that implies a comparatively limited long-term track record and the possibility of capacity or staffing variability as the agency expands. Review content offers little direct information about pricing, billing practices, or long-term care coordination (care-plan evolution, complex care management), so those operational details warrant direct inquiry during intake. Overall, the reviews portray a company with strong caregiver warmth, responsive office practices, and clear onboarding, balanced against the normal uncertainties associated with a newer, expanding provider.
